ND13 EXL is a 2013 Mini Cooper S Auto in Black with a 1,600c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2013 Mini Cooper S Auto models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.4% with a typical mileage of 36,186 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mini Cooper S Auto f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 38 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ND13 EXL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mini Cooper S Auto typ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 13 years old, this Mini Cooper S Auto is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
